#5b4263 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b4263 is composed of 35.7% red, 25.9%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 285.5 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 32.4%. #5b4263 color hex could be obtained by blending #b684c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#5b4263 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.

#5b4263 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5b4263 has RGB values of R:91, G:66,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 5980771.

Shades and Tints of #5b4263

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040305 is the darkest color, while #faf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b4263

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544f56 is the less saturated color, while #7c03a2 is the most saturated one.
